SHUTDOWN(2)  —  Kubota Pacfic Computer Inc. (System Calls−BSD)

NAME

shutdown − shut down part of a full-duplex connection

SYNOPSIS

shutdown(s, how)
int s, how;

DESCRIPTION

The shutdown call causes all or part of a full-duplex connection on the socket associated with s to be shut down.  If how is 0, then further receives are disallowed.  If how is 1, then further sends are disallowed.  If how is 2, then further sends and receives are disallowed. 

DIAGNOSTICS

A 0 is returned if the call succeeds, −1 if it fails. 

ERRORS

The call succeeds unless:

[EBADF] s is not a valid descriptor. 

[ENOTSOCK] s is a file, not a socket. 

[ENOTCONN] The specified socket is not connected.
